RTB Production Crews Attended 3D Animation Workshop


 


 March 25th, 2016  |  10:12 AM  |   3602 views

JALAN SUNGAI AKAR, BRUNEI-MUARA

 

Twelve production staff members from Radio Televisyen Brunei (RTB) are currently participating in a five-day 3D Animation Workshop at the RTB Complex in Jalan Sungai Akar.

 

The workshop, which will end on March 26, is a joint programme between RTB and the National Broadcasting Service of Thailand (NBT), under a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) between the Government of Brunei Darussalam and the Government of the Kingdom of Thailand on mutual cooperation in the field of information and broadcasting.

 

The workshop is conducted by two trainers from Thailand, Thaveewat Vanichpinyo and Pattawat Pongpanich, who are both experts in producing 3D animated videos.

 

With the development of New Media Technology, the application of 3D animation in local productions should be favourable to output and work performances in the long term.

 

In an interview with NBT-MoU Coordinator Surasak Hunsa Chaleekon, he explained that the workshop aims to provide basic knowledge and experience on 3D animation to RTB's production staff.
